Check Digit Verification of cas no

The CAS Registry Mumber 100144-83-0 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,0,0,1,4 and 4 respectively; the second part has 2 digits, 8 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 100144-83:
(8*1)+(7*0)+(6*0)+(5*1)+(4*4)+(3*4)+(2*8)+(1*3)=60
60 % 10 = 0
So 100144-83-0 is a valid CAS Registry Number.

Palladium(II)-catalyzed formation of γ-butyrolactones from 4-trimethylsilyl-3-alkyn-1-ols: Synthetic and mechanistic aspects

Compain, Philippe,Gore, Jacques,Vatele, Jean-Michel

, p. 10405 - 10416 (2007/10/03)

γ-butyrolactones are obtained in good yields from 4-trimethylsilyl-3-alkyn-1-ols via Wacker-type oxidation reaction. A mechanism is proposed for this transformation: it involves two successive trans-hydroxypalladations followed by a [PdXSiMe3] syn-elimination and explains why the presence of the silyl group is essential in such a process.

On the crossed-aldol reaction of cyclohexane-1,2-dione with acetone, and the preparation of pyrroline derivatives from the product

Strunz, George M.,Yu, Chao-Mei

, p. 1081 - 1083 (2007/10/02)

Acetone reacts with cyclohexane-1,2-dione, on refluxing in the presence of potassium carbonate, to give the crossed-aldol product, 2-hydroxy-2-acetonylcyclohexanone, 2 (R = CH3).Other methyl ketones react similarly with cyclohexane-1,2-dione.This is believed to be a consequence of unfavourable dipole interaction in the 1,2-dione.The product, on reaction with liquid ammonia, afforded the 5-amino-4-hydroxy-1-pyrroline derivative, 5, which was reduced with lithium aluminium hydride to the 3-hydroxy-1-pyrroline, 7.
